QXO Inc is a publicly traded distributor of building products in North America. The company is executing its plan to become the tech-enabled leader in the around $800 billion building products distribution industry and generate outsized value for its shareholders. The group expects to achieve its target of nearly $50 billion in annual revenues within the next decade through accretive acquisitions and organic growth.
PayPay Corp is a FinTech company in Japan that operates a digital finance platform centered on payments, offering a range of payment and financial services to users and merchants. The company has two reportable segments: i) Payment segment: It includes payment settlement services and related services through its PayPay app, and credit payment settlement services such as revolving and installment payment options and cash advances; and ii) Financial service segment: It includes internet banking services, securities intermediary services and PayPay Point investment-related services, and loan management services. The majority of revenue is derived from the Payment segment. Geographically, the company's maximum revenue is generated in Japan.
